DescriptionVenturi Astrolab, Inc. (Astrolab) is pioneering new ways to explore and operate on distant planetary bodies. We are singularly focused on designing, building, and operating a fleet of multi-purpose commercial planetary rovers to extend and enhance humanity’s presence in the solar system. We are seeking motivated, creative, and exceptional people to join our world-class team.
Astrolab is seeking a visionary Director of Sales & Business Development with a unique blend of business acumen, technical expertise and leadership experience to drive our lunar payload delivery business. The ideal candidate will excel at selling our lunar payload delivery services to a diverse customer base, including engineers, government entities, brands, and space enthusiasts.
